Justin Rose Rolls Back the Years – A Record-Breaking Performance

Justin Rose, the 44-year-old Englishman, stunned the sporting world with a vintage display, surging to a first-round 65 to seize control of the Masters leaderboard. Rose, making his 20th appearance at Augusta, seemed immune to pressure, lighting up the course with eight birdies and only one dropped shot at the 18th hole. It was a game-changer of a performance that placed him three strokes clear of the field.

For those asking, “Has Justin Rose won a Masters?”, the answer is no—yet. Despite coming heartbreakingly close in both 2015 and 2017, the green jacket has eluded him. But if this opening round is any indication, Rose might finally seize the prize that has so long remained just out of reach.



Rory McIlroy's Pursuit Crumbles – What Happened Next Will Surprise You

While Justin Rose soared, Rory McIlroy spiraled. The Northern Irishman started strong and was tied for second with defending champion Scottie Scheffler, sitting at -4 with just four holes to play. Then, catastrophe struck.

On the par-5 15th, McIlroy’s second shot found the water—Rae’s Creek claimed another victim. His chip shot rolled over the green and down the slope, turning a potential birdie into a calamitous double-bogey. On 17, his approach shot flew long, and a misjudged putt turned another fairway opportunity into another double-bogey. By the time McIlroy reached the 18th, he was merely holding on.

He managed a par to close, finishing with a 72 and sitting at even-par—seven shots behind Rose, and tied for 26th. The implosion raised numerous questions and sparked headlines like:

Who's the Leader in the Masters Right Now?

That title belongs firmly to Justin Rose, who sits atop the Masters leaderboard today at -7. He is followed by Scottie Scheffler and Corey Conners at -4. Bryson DeChambeau, Ludvig Aberg, and Tyrrell Hatton follow closely at -3.

Rose’s clinical round of 65 was the only sub-66 round of the day. For context, defending champion Scheffler produced a flawless, bogey-free round to begin his title defense and sits in an excellent position to contend across the weekend.

Big Money: How Much Will the Winner of the Masters Get?

For those curious about the financial stakes, how much will the winner of the Masters get? The 2025 Masters champion is expected to take home a staggering $3.6 million, part of a record $18 million prize pool. That figure has risen sharply in recent years, reflecting the tournament’s growing commercial reach and global prestige.
